Subject: Re: [PATCH -next 3/4] spi: mockup: Add runtime device tree overlay interface
Date: Wed, 31 Aug 2022 12:44:48 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<a4a24a54-c864-e5ed-7e17-84b7a55996af@huawei.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<7111c94c-a85c-2f51-f94b-ed60080b1717@gmail.com>



On 2022/8/31 3:24, Frank Rowand wrote:
> On 8/30/22 05:27, Mark Brown wrote:
>> On Fri, Aug 26, 2022 at 02:43:40PM +0000, Wei Yongjun wrote:
>>
>>> Add a runtime device tree overlay interface for device need dts file.
>>> With it its possible to use device tree overlays without having to use
>>> a per-platform overlay manager.
>>
>> Why would an entirely virtual device like this need to appear in
>> DT?  DT is supposed to be a hardware description and this clearly
>> isn't hardware, nor is it something we're providing to a VM.
> 
> Good point.  Patch 3 seems to not be needed.

Yes, will drop it in next version.
